There is no change in the position of the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am on the issue of Presidential election, which was communicated to Defence Minister A.K. Antony when he called on DMK president M. Karunanidhi [on April 29].

Clarifying this at a press meet on Thursday, Mr. Karunanidhi said Congress president Sonia Gandhi, through Mr. Antony, had conveyed to him the prospective Presidential candidate. He had agreed with the choice, the DMK leader said, telling reporters not to ask him who the candidate was.
